The Symbiosis College of Arts and Commerce admissions are dependent on the basic eligibility criteria as well as the performance of the qualifying test for all courses. SCAC Pune offers admission to courses in the field of arts and commerce such as B.A, B.Com, M.A, M.Com, B.A Hons., B.Com Hons., etc. The admission eligibility and selection criteria criteria of these courses are listed in the table below:

SCAC Pune Application Process:

Following the release of the 12th-grade results, candidates are required to submit their applications online at the college’s official website. Below is the application process for Symbiosis College of Arts and Commerce Pune:

  • Fill out the pre-merit application form by downloading it.
  • pay the application fee. 
  • Send the completed pre-merit application form and payment challan to the college. You have the option of doing this in person or via mail. 

Keep watching the official website for the merit list. The student has two days from the time the institution verifies the documents to complete the online application and pay the admission fee. 

The documents required for verification include:

  • 10th standard Mark sheet
  • 10+2 std. Mark sheet
  • Migration certificate
  • All semester academic mark sheets of graduation (if applied for PG)
  • Government identity proof (Aadhar card/ voter ID card/ driving license/ passport/ PAN card)
  • Address proof
